More time for federal employees to submit injury compensation documents.

This new act extends the period federal employees have to submit supporting documents for workers' compensation claims. They will now have 60 days instead of 30 days to provide the necessary paperwork. This change aims to make it easier for individuals seeking benefits for work-related injuries or illnesses.
